Goshen woman arrested for illegal drug conveyance

LEBANON – A Goshen woman will appear in the Lebanon Municipal Court this afternoon for attempting to convey marijuana into the Lebanon Correctional Institution after Ohio State Highway Patrol troopers arrested her Saturday.

Troopers charged Lee Ann Warrick, 26, with conveying illegal narcotics onto the grounds of a correctional facility, a third-degree felony.

Troopers and Department of Rehabilitation and Correction investigators obtained information that Warrick planned to convey illegal drugs into the Lebanon Correctional Institution. Troopers arrested Warrick at 8:30 a.m. Saturday after finding three and one half grams of marijuana in balloons concealed in her clothing.

Warrick was incarcerated at the Warren County Jail. If convicted, she could face up to five years in prison and a $10,000 fine.

The Ohio State Highway Patrol investigates criminal activity on state owned and leased property.
